Analysis
The most recent figure for emissions on agricultural land — emissions in Russian Federation is 185.07 kt, measured in 2023.
That represents a change of down 0.9% on the previous year and up 21.5% over ten years.
Over the whole period, emissions on agricultural land — emissions in Russian Federation peaked at 279.27 kt in 1992 and was at its lowest, 145.84 kt, in 2006.
Russian Federation ranks 10th of 222 countries on this measure, in the top 10%.
The long-run direction has been consistently falling across the 32 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
